Rafael Nadal Announces He Will Miss This Year’s Us Open, With The 38-year-old Tennis Legend Hinting At Ongoing Injury Struggles

Tennis legend Rafael Nadal has announced that he will not participate in this year’s US Open. The 38-year-old Spanish star cited ongoing injury struggles as the primary reason for his decision to withdraw from the prestigious Grand Slam event.

Nadal, who has been a dominant force in tennis throughout his career, has faced a series of injury-related setbacks in recent seasons. His decision to skip the US Open reflects the challenges he has been grappling with in managing his physical condition and ensuring a full recovery.

The announcement has sent ripples through the tennis world, as Nadal’s absence from the tournament will be a significant loss for fans and competitors alike. Known for his remarkable performances on hard courts and his incredible resilience, Nadal’s participation is often eagerly anticipated.

In his statement, Nadal expressed regret over missing the event but emphasized the importance of prioritizing his health and well-being. He has hinted at ongoing struggles with his injuries, which have affected his ability to compete at the highest level.

As Nadal takes time to focus on his recovery, the tennis community will be watching closely to see how he bounces back from this setback. His withdrawal from the US Open opens the door for other players to seize the opportunity and could impact the dynamics of the tournament.
